Whenever I read that Coronation Street's filmed two endings in a cliffhanger storyline, I always think to myself that they probably haven't, I mean, when would they have the time to do so? But in the case of Gail McIntyre at court, two endings have indeed been filmed and both were witnessed by shoppers and members of the public who were outside Bradford City Hall to watch events unfold.
It says here that in one scene Gail McIntyre came out of the building flanked by David, Nick and Audrey. Chased by reporters and photographers, played by extras, they ran to a waiting cab, giving the impression that Gail had been acquitted. Running down the City Hall steps Gail cried: “Tina, you heard what the judge said!” Tina was clearly distressed at the outcome of the Court case and was comforted by her on-screen boyfriend Jason.
In an alternative scene, David, Nick and Audrey came down the steps looking upset, with David angrily confronting Tina. Street busybodies Norris and Mary stood at the bottom of the steps, watching the action unfold.
A spokesman for the production team said two outcomes were being filmed. Fans will be on tenterhooks until the summer to find out Gail’s fate.
